The new capabilities of the RGB Networks TransAct Packager are a "great win" for operators because they define Just-In-Time Packaging (JITP), one Diamonds judge said, applauding the fact that the product now can support multiple formats. It will save on the bandwidth and processing time associated with providing adaptive bitrate VOD, nDVR and TV Everywhere services, he said.
The JITP technology adds to the TransAct Packager the ability to handle on-the-fly packaging, in real-time when a subscriber requests the content. This eliminates the need for operators to prepackage all video assets in the different adaptive streaming protocols.RGB points out that as operators move toward supporting standards such as MPEG-DASH, converting a content library would be costly and time consuming, "especially when the uptake is uncertain." Likewise, Apple continues to upgrade HLS, so users may have devices running with all different versions.
